Summary Creede of Old Montana follows the exploits and heartbreaks of Avery John Creede, an ex-calvary soldier, as he tramps along the upper Missouri River in search of four Army pals who didn't show up for a scheduled reunion. Throughout Creede's confrontations and adventures, three things remain constant: his courage, his rock-solid faith, and his wounded heart. He knows the first two will never change. And at forty-two, he's not sure the third ever will either.
